What is the Prostate?

The prostate is an accessory gland in all male mammals1. It is about the size of a walnut, weighing about 11 grams, and is located in the pelvis, below the urinary bladder, and surrounds the male urethra2. It is covered by an elastic fibromuscular capsule and contains glandular as well as non-glandular component3

The prostate also needs male hormones, mainly androgens and testosterone, for optimum functioning. It doubles in size during the teenage years and then continues to grow after 25 years of age.

How Common Are the Prostate Problems in Men?

Prostate problems are actually one of the most common medical problems that man over 40 have to face.

Prostate enlargement, or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H), is quite a common problem for men. Almost half of all men aged 50 to 60 have BPH to a certain degree4. And up to 90% of men over 80 have it.

Similarly, prostate cancer is the second most common cause of death in men. Of all the tumors, the prevalence of prostatic tumors increases the most rapidly with age5. The medical advances which lead to an increase in the survival and age of the US male population also cause the increase in the overall prevalence of prostatic tumors. 

How do you know that you have a Prostate Problem?

Prostate enlargement and other related problems are characterized by irritable symptoms, typically related to the urinary tract. 

In BPH, there is an abnormal increase in the proliferation of the smooth muscle cells, epithelial cells, and stromal cells in the prostate. As the prostate gland enlarges, it compresses the urethra. As a result, the wall of the urinary bladder thickens, and the bladder loses its ability to empty. It leads to many problems collectively labeled lower urinary tract symptoms (LUTS). These include:

  • Urinary frequency: the need to urinate often, even every hour
  • Urinary hesitancy: taking a while to get started 
  • Urinary incontinence: leaking or dribbling of urine
  • Urinary retention: the feeling that the bladder is full despite passing urine
  • Intermittent urination: stopping and starting several times while passing urine
  • Weak stream: weak urine flow
  • Nocturia: the need to wake up several times at night to pass urine
  • Urinary urgency: feeling the urgent need to pass urine; otherwise, you will spoil the clothes
  • Straining: having difficulty in starting to pass urine as the urethra becomes constricted
  • Urinary retention: when BPH becomes severe, you might not be able to pass urine at all

Other than urinary problems, an enlarged prostate causes sexual difficulties, and these various symptoms can easily degrade the patient’s overall quality of life in a very short time.

Prevention and Treatment of BPH

Various lead researchers at Harvard have recommended general preventive health measures for the enlargement of the prostate, such as:

  • A healthy Mediterranean diet, together with reduced consumption of red meat.
  • Exercise for 30 minutes 5 times a week.
  • Adopting measures to reduce stress, such as meditation.

Treatment of BPH generally includes:

  • Active surveillance: If the symptoms are not severe, the wait-and-watch policy is adopted. BPH is closely monitored but not actively treated. If symptoms worsen or new symptoms appear, the treatment is started.
  • Medications: Various medicines help shrink or relax the muscles near the prostate6. These include:
    • Alpha-blockers relax the muscles in the urethra and the neck of the bladder, thus improving urine flow
    • Five alpha-reductase inhibitors inhibit the con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T). DHT slows or stops the growth of the prostate, which prevents the death of prostate cells. Thus, 5 alpha-reductase inhibitors increase the urine flow and help shrink the prostate.
  • Surgery: If other treatments prove ineffective, surgery, such as transurethral resection, can help with the urine flow. However, the surgical procedure carries risks and complications, especially for the elderly.
  • Other treatments: Sometimes heat, with the help of microwaves or lasers, is used to reduce extra prostate tissue.
